Into the Wild — Norman | The Story
A black-maned lion of the Kalahari.
Long before he arrived at Tswalu, Norman had already earned his place among Africa's great lions. Alongside his cousin Zwaai, he survived battles for territory, rival coalitions, and the constant challenges of life in the wild.
When the two lions were relocated to Tswalu, many expected old rivalries to continue. Instead, something remarkable happened. Former enemies became allies, forming one of the most formidable lion coalitions in the reserve.
This portrait is Norman as I remember him, powerful, watchful, and utterly at home in the vast Kalahari landscape.
A reminder that true strength is not always found in conflict. Sometimes it is found in endurance.
